Transaction 2e7be9918d4f6c93fc4dbf3576c8593a4354235f4ed90806bd298fa35e0d3111

1 Input
2 Outputs
  • 2e7be9918d4f6c93fc4dbf3576c8593a4354235f4ed90806bd298fa35e0d3111:0
  • value  25225753
    address  3HfT7ZgKjgSA3iN4oquvuHr96bQ7Mfoqzj
  • 2e7be9918d4f6c93fc4dbf3576c8593a4354235f4ed90806bd298fa35e0d3111:1
  • value  1115692384
    address  1FbR6cCYwV3YAF2VJffdAczCZyofkgaY59